Private Elegant Waterfront Home, 4 Acres, Views! Fam Friendly!

4000 square foot river front log home elegantly expanded and updated, on three acres of woods with rolling fields and stone walls down to private waterfront with sunset view beyond the river. Huge living room with picture windows and stone fireplace. Large master suite with jacuzzi tub in bathroom and dressing area with sink and walk-in closet. Equally large kids' room with two bunk beds and bath with shower. Separate area with two guest bedrooms and two full bathrooms. Cozy media room for reading, music or watching 42' HD TV via satellite. DSL and printer, washer and dryer. Full dining room. Fully equipped kitchen with dishwasher and disposal. Screen porch with furniture for breakfasts with view of the lake, or summer dinners on the grill. Large deck with incredible view of the Connecticut River and sunsets. Community consists of approximately thirty vacation homes with six hundred acres, hiking trails, beaver pond and caretaker. Twenty minutes from historic St Johnsbury VT, with natural history museum and athenaeum and twenty minutes from Littleton, NH. One hour from Mt Washington, and children's attractions, including Six-gun City, Whale's Tale water park and Santa's Village . Two hours, forty minutes from Boston, two hours from Burlington, VT.

We are a family of four (with two grown daughters) now spread between California and Florida, though we raised our children in Boston with summers in our Vermont house. Having retired to Florida, the house does not get as much use, and we decided it was time to share our special home on the Connecticut River with others!

Why they chose this property

Within easy reach of Boston, the setting was perfect for a peaceful weekend out of the city. With small children, the ability to let them roam the woods and river was priceless, while the river sports, hiking and tennis proved relaxing for adults as well.

What makes this property unique

A morning swim in the river, when the water is like glass and the birds are out, followed by coffee on the porch, is the perfect summer morning.

Foliage season is spectacular in this area, with the woods surrounding the house ablaze with color. Crisp morning hikes with leaves underfoot is a fall treat - try to take in the fall colors from the lookout point at the top of Chamberlin Mt, a 45 minute hike you can start from the front door!
